Solar Battery Types

The four main types of batteries used in the world of solar power are lead-acid, lithium-ion, nickel-cadmium, and flow batteries.

  1. Lithium-ion batteries – These are the most popular type of solar battery, and they are known for their longevity. When properly cared for, they can last up to twenty years. This makes them a great choice for larger solar energy systems. 
  2. Lead acid batteries – These are also popular, but they tend to have a shorter lifespan. With proper care, they can last between five to ten years. Sealed lead acid batteries tend to have the shortest lifespan, typically lasting less than five years.
  3. Nickel-cadmium batteries –These batteries are rarely used in residential settings and are most popular in airline and industrial applications due to their high durability and unique ability to function at extreme temperatures. These batteries require relatively low amounts of maintenance when compared to other battery types.
  4. Flow batteries – Flow batteries depend on chemical reactions. Energy is reproduced by liquid-containing electrolytes flowing between two chambers within the battery. Though flow batteries offer high efficiency, with a depth of discharge of 100%, they have a low energy density, meaning the tanks containing the electrolyte liquid must be quite large to store a significant amount of energy. Flow batteries are much better suited to larger spaces and applications.

5 Reasons Why You Need a Solar Battery Backup

1) TO KEEP THE POWER ON DURING A POWER OUTAGE

A battery backup for your solar energy system can be a lifesaver during a power outage. With battery backup, you can keep your home powered up with solar energy when the main power source fails. The batteries are designed to store energy generated from the sun and use it to power your home when the electric grid is not available. 

2) TO KEEP YOUR DEVICES CHARGED

Having a battery backup for solar panels is a great way to ensure that your devices stay charged during a power outage. A battery backup system stores excess energy from the solar panel during peak hours and releases it when the demand is high, such as during an outage. 

3) TO SAVE MONEY ON YOUR ELECTRIC BILL

A solar power system is an excellent way to save money on your electric bill. If you have a battery backed solar system, you will be able to use the stored energy during peak demand hours or when electricity rates are high. In other words, having a battery backup for your solar panels can help you take advantage of time-of-use electricity rates to maximize savings on your electric bill.

4) TO BE PREPARED FOR AN EMERGENCY

Battery backup for solar systems ensures that when there is a power outage, your home or business will still have access to power. This can be particularly helpful if you are in an area that experiences natural disasters like snow and ice storms, hurricanes, floods, and earthquakes.
